    Default Scholomance 4 Mages 1 Priest 37min run (Video)

    This is a video of me multiboxing 4 mages and my friend play his priest. I have seen a lot of people saying that dungeon runs at level 60 would be too hard for 4 mages/1 priest without a tank... Yesterday I decided to record one of our runs in scholomance so I could show you guys that 4 mages and 1 priest works really good in PvE, even at level 60. So far we have been able to clear every dungeone without any problems. I am completely new to this game so I still have a lot to learn about game mechanics but I hope this video will help some of you that play 4 mages / 1 priest.

    Impressive - very nice. How have you been faring in Dire Maul (north) and Strath? I imagine some of the boss ogres in DM and Ramstein in Strath could be tricky without a tank?

    I'm also loving the clever use of shackle / poly as a way to keep mobs at distance - makes we want to level 2 more mages 2 60, just to try it out :-D (currently running war/pri/2xmage/lock)

    My classic team of 4xLock Priest is 22, and I will be replacing them with mages (rerolling on Ashbringer EU Alliance) I have tested these teams on pserver but because elite mob damage values are too high I was under the impression that mages can't survive some things, which is false on classic. For example skeletons at the start of Scholomance melted any clothie they touched, but on retail they hit less often, probably because they use their enrage ability way later, mobs use their abilities less often and sub 50 mob damage is way lower then on pservers.
